#aa5c71 - Topinambur Root color
A dusky rose with muted mauve undertones, balancing warm pink with a touch of earthy brown to create a sophisticated, vintage feel. It reads romantic yet grounded, flattering both matte and satin finishes. Pair it with warm neutrals like taupe and cream, deep charcoal or moss green for contrast, or soft gold accents for a refined highlight. Ideal for accent walls, textiles, cosmetics, and packaging where a mature, feminine but restrained mood is desired.
#aa5c71 color RGB value is 170, 92, 113, and the CMYK value is 0.00, 0.459, 0.335, 0.333. Alternative names for that color are: topinambur root, brown, palevioletred, tapestry, chestnut, violet.
